From 2018 to 2021
The main materials used for manufacturing cardboard boxes in China
Production and sales volume of cardboard and corrugated paper
Both continue to grow
The average annual growth rates of production volume are 9.35% and 8.45%, respectively
The average annual growth rate of consumption has reached 10%
2021
The consumption of these two main types of packaging paper in China
Over 31 million tons and 29 million tons respectively
The output of corrugated cardboard box industry reached 34.44 million tons
Year on year growth of 8.62%
The growth momentum abruptly came to an end in 2022
Under the epidemic situation
Double impact of supply and demand
Causing a large number of factories to shut down
Cardboard box backlog
Carton and paper prices fluctuate downward
Many paper mills voluntarily shut down for maintenance
Reduce construction
However, the downward trend seems to have not stopped yet
2022
The prices of cardboard and corrugated paper nationwide have dropped by 10% -20%
The production of corrugated cardboard boxes in the industry decreased by 4.45% year-on-year
As of early June this year
The ex factory price of 140g specification corrugated paper has dropped to about 3400 yuan per ton
It has decreased by 11% compared to the beginning of the year
This indirectly reflects the sluggish sales of various consumer goods
The severity of the economic situation is evident from this
A similar scene also occurred in the United States across the ocean
Q4 2022
The shipment volume of cardboard boxes in the United States decreased by 8.4% year-on-year
The operating rate of cardboard box manufacturers has dropped to 80.9%
Both data are the lowest since 2009
The 21 largest pulp and paper companies in North America
The profit margin in the first quarter of this year decreased by 5.8% year-on-year
Total revenue decreased by about 60% year-on-year
